云数据库到底是什么

fiy 其他 7

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    云数据库(Cloud Database)是一种基于云计算技术的数据库服务。它将数据库的存储和处理能力移植到云环境中,使用户可以通过互联网访问和管理数据库,而无需自己购买、部署和维护硬件设备和软件系统。

    以下是云数据库的几个重要特点和功能:

    1. 弹性扩展:云数据库可以根据用户的需求自动扩展和缩减存储空间和计算资源。用户可以根据实际需要灵活地增加或减少数据库的容量和性能,从而节省成本并满足业务需求。

    2. 高可用性和容错性:云数据库通常采用分布式架构和多副本技术,可以在多个数据中心进行数据备份和容灾,以保证数据的可靠性和持久性。即使某个数据中心发生故障,也能够自动切换到其他可用的数据中心,保证数据库的连续性和可用性。

    3. 数据安全和隐私保护:云数据库提供了多种安全措施,包括数据加密、身份认证、访问控制等,可以保护用户的数据免受未授权访问和数据泄露的风险。同时,云数据库通常符合相关的数据隐私法规和合规要求,确保用户数据的合法性和隐私保护。

    4. 灵活的数据模型和查询语言:云数据库支持多种数据模型,包括关系型数据库、文档数据库、键值数据库等,可以根据不同的应用场景选择合适的数据模型。同时,云数据库提供了丰富的查询语言和功能,可以方便地进行数据查询、分析和处理。

    5. 可定制化的管理和监控:云数据库提供了丰富的管理工具和监控功能,可以帮助用户进行数据库的配置、备份、恢复、性能调优等操作。用户可以根据自己的需求定制数据库的管理策略,并监控数据库的运行状态和性能指标,及时发现和解决问题。

    总之,云数据库通过将数据库服务迁移到云端,为用户提供了高效、可靠、安全、灵活的数据库解决方案,帮助用户降低成本、提高效率,并满足不同应用场景的需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    云数据库是一种基于云计算技术的数据库服务,它将传统的数据库系统部署在云平台上,提供了可扩展、高可用、灵活的存储和管理数据的能力。

    传统的数据库系统需要在本地服务器上进行安装和配置,需要维护硬件设备和软件,而云数据库则将这些工作都交给了云服务提供商。用户只需通过互联网连接到云数据库服务,即可使用数据库功能,无需关心底层的硬件和软件配置。

    云数据库具有以下几个主要特点:

    1. 可扩展性:云数据库可以根据实际需求进行弹性扩展。用户可以根据数据量的增长,动态调整数据库的存储容量,而无需购买和维护额外的硬件设备。这使得数据库可以随着业务的发展而快速扩展,提供高性能的数据存储和访问能力。

    2. 高可用性:云数据库采用了分布式架构,数据可以在多个节点上进行复制和备份,提供高可用性和容错能力。即使某个节点发生故障,系统仍然可以继续运行,不会造成数据丢失和服务中断。

    3. 灵活性:云数据库支持多种数据库引擎和数据模型,可以满足不同应用场景的需求。用户可以根据实际情况选择适合自己的数据库类型,如关系型数据库(如MySQL、Oracle)、NoSQL数据库(如MongoDB、Redis)、时序数据库等。

    4. 安全性:云数据库提供了多层次的安全措施,包括身份认证、数据加密、访问控制等。用户可以通过设置权限和访问策略,确保只有授权的人员可以访问和修改数据库中的数据,保护数据的安全性和完整性。

    5. 弹性计费:云数据库采用了按需计费的模式,用户只需根据实际使用情况支付费用,避免了购买和维护硬件设备的成本。用户可以根据业务的变化灵活调整数据库的规模和容量,实现成本的最优化。

    总之,云数据库是一种基于云计算技术的数据库服务,通过利用云平台的弹性和可扩展性,提供了高性能、高可用、灵活和安全的数据存储和管理能力,为用户提供了更便捷、经济和可靠的数据库解决方案。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    云数据库是一种基于云计算技术的数据库服务,它提供了可扩展、高可用、安全可靠的数据存储和管理功能。云数据库可以运行在云服务提供商的服务器上,用户可以通过互联网访问和管理自己的数据。

    云数据库通常具有以下特点:

    1. 可扩展性:云数据库可以根据需求自动扩展存储容量和计算资源,无需手动调整硬件设备或软件配置。

    2. 高可用性:云数据库通常会在多个地理位置部署数据副本,以实现数据的冗余备份和故障恢复,保证数据的可靠性和可用性。

    3. 弹性计费:云数据库通常采用按需付费的模式,用户只需按照实际使用的资源量付费,可以灵活调整和控制数据库的成本。

    4. 安全性:云数据库提供了多种安全机制,如数据加密、访问控制、身份认证等,保护用户的数据不被未授权的访问和篡改。

    5. 管理简单:云数据库提供了简单易用的管理工具和界面,用户可以方便地进行数据的备份、恢复、监控和优化等操作。

    云数据库可以支持多种数据库类型,如关系型数据库(如MySQL、Oracle、SQL Server等)、NoSQL数据库(如MongoDB、Redis、Cassandra等)和时序数据库(如InfluxDB、OpenTSDB等)。用户可以根据自己的业务需求选择适合的数据库类型和规模。

    在使用云数据库时,用户需要进行以下操作流程:

    1. 创建数据库实例:用户需要选择数据库类型、存储容量、计算资源等参数,然后在云服务提供商的控制台上创建一个数据库实例。

    2. 配置数据库:用户需要设置数据库的用户名、密码、网络访问权限等配置项,以保证数据库的安全性和可访问性。

    3. 导入数据:用户可以通过数据导入工具或API将现有的数据导入到云数据库中,以便进行后续的数据查询和分析。

    4. 数据操作:用户可以使用数据库管理工具或编程接口进行数据的增删改查操作,以满足业务需求。

    5. 数据备份和恢复:用户可以定期进行数据备份,以防止数据丢失或意外删除。如果发生数据丢失或故障,用户可以使用备份数据进行恢复。

    6. 数据监控和优化:用户可以使用监控工具和性能分析工具对数据库进行监控和优化,以提高数据库的性能和可靠性。

    总之,云数据库是一种灵活、可扩展、高可用的数据库解决方案,可以帮助用户快速构建和管理数据服务,降低数据库运维成本,提高数据处理效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部